Abstract

In this paper, a new concept discussed along with general lines. In present situation the natural resources are severely depleted, which makes animals to enter human living area and agricultural field, so it is necessary to monitor the agricultural field continuously in order to prevent the entry of animals. In our proposed paper, wireless peafowl repellent system using ATmega328 is used to prevent peafowl and other animals from destroying crops in agricultural field. By using audio amplifier various kind of animals sound is produced due to this peafowl are driven back out of the field
